Cedar Ridge has been on the road for two straight, but on Monday they'll finally head home. They will host the Western Alamance Warriors at 6:45 p.m.

Cedar Ridge is coming in off a wild two-game stretch: after soaring to four goals on Wednesday, they were much more limited against Orange on Thursday. They lost 6-1 to the Panthers. While losing is never fun, the Fighting Red Wolves can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' North Carolina soccer rankings (they are ranked 338th, while the Panthers are ranked 132nd).

Meanwhile, Western Alamance entered their tilt with Williams on Wednesday with 14 cons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with 15. They came out on top against the Bulldogs by a score of 3-1. The game got a bit rough at times, as the refs handed out a total of three yellow cards before it was all over: the Warriors' Brian Villanueva-Herrera and the Bulldogs' Gustavo Duran and Justin Hernandez were all carded.

Konner Johnson and Grant Bacchus scored all three of Western Alamance's goals, bringing their combined season tally to 21 goals.

Cedar Ridge's defeat dropped their record down to 6-8-2. As for Western Alamance, their victory was their eighth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 16-1.

Cedar Ridge might still be hurting after the 6-0 loss they got from Western Alamance in their previous meeting back in September. Will Cedar Ridge have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check MaxPreps after the action for a full breakdown of the game and more soccer content.
